连接远程阿里云服务器
在当今数字化时代,远程连接服务器已成为许多企业和开发者日常工作的重要组成部分。无论是进行软件开发、数据分析还是系统维护,能够高效地连接到远程服务器都是至关重要的。本文将探讨如何通过专业的技术手段实现与远程阿里云服务器的稳定连接,并分析其背后的技术原理和最佳实践。
首先,要实现与远程服务器的连接,我们需要了解一些基本的网络协议和工具。SSH(Secure Shell)是一种常用的网络协议,用于加密方式远程登录和管理服务器。它不仅可以保证数据传输的安全性,还提供了一种方便的命令行接口来执行远程命令。此外,还有一些其他的工具和协议,如Telnet、FTP等,但它们在安全性方面相对较弱,因此不推荐在生产环境中使用。
为了连接到远程阿里云服务器,我们首先需要获取服务器的公网IP地址或域名。这通常可以在购买服务器时获得,或者通过云服务提供商的控制台查询得到。接下来,我们需要使用SSH客户端工具来建立连接。常见的SSH客户端工具包括PuTTY(Windows平台)、Terminal(MacOS和Linux平台)等。以PuTTY为例,我们只需要输入服务器的IP地址、端口号(默认为22)以及登录凭证(用户名和密码),即可成功连接到远程服务器。
然而,仅仅能够连接到服务器是不够的,我们还需要确保连接的稳定性和安全性。为此,我们可以采取以下措施:
1. 使用密钥认证代替密码认证。密钥认证是一种更安全的身份验证方式,它使用一对公钥和私钥来验证用户的身份。用户可以将公钥保存在服务器上,而私钥则保存在自己的计算机上。当用户尝试登录服务器时,服务器会要求用户提供私钥,只有拥有正确私钥的用户才能成功登录。这种方式可以有效防止密码被窃取或破解的风险。
2. 配置防火墙规则。为了防止未经授权的访问,我们应该在服务器上配置适当的防火墙规则。例如,只允许特定的IP地址或IP段访问服务器的特定端口。这样可以有效减少潜在的安全威胁。
3. 定期更新系统和软件。保持系统和软件的最新状态是确保安全性的重要措施之一。定期检查并安装安全补丁可以修复已知的漏洞和弱点,提高系统的整体安全性。
4. 使用VPN(虚拟专用网络)。如果需要在公共网络上连接远程服务器,建议使用VPN来加密传输的数据流。VPN可以在公共网络上建立一个安全的隧道,保护数据免受窃听和篡改的风险。
除了以上措施外,我们还可以通过优化网络设置和使用专业的网络监控工具来提高连接的稳定性和性能。例如,选择合适的网络拓扑结构、调整TCP/IP参数、使用负载均衡器等都可以帮助我们更好地管理网络流量和提高连接质量。同时,定期对网络进行监控和分析也是非常重要的,它可以帮助我们及时发现并解决潜在的问题。
总之,通过合理的技术手段和最佳实践的应用,我们可以实现与远程阿里云服务器的稳定连接,并确保数据的安全性和隐私性。这不仅可以提高我们的工作效率和生产力,还可以为企业的发展提供有力的支持。在未来的发展中,随着云计算技术的不断进步和完善,我们有理由相信远程连接服务器将会变得更加便捷、高效和安全。